A spa day at Bota Bota, spa-sur-l’eau
A perfect way to relax before or after throwing that wine and cheese get together is to spend a few hours going around Bota Bota’s relaxing water circuit with a friend and the city’s skyline for a background. It is hands down one of the most beautiful and unusual spas you will ever experience.
